    iRobot Roomba 690 Robot Vacuum with Wi-Fi Connectivity, Works with Alexa, Good for Pet Hair, Carpets, Hard Floors

    • It also detects cliffs where there clearly isn't one, just a rug with dark coloring
    • Clean up debris (I saw it miss on light colored hard floors if that helps anyone) 2
    • -It is pretty good at avoiding running headlong into things, but darker color objects seem to be tougher for it to recognize.-Not useful on any carpet, except possibly some very thin runners.-I wish it could map the apartment and do it's cleaning in a more organized
    • But if you have dark colored carpets be ready to constantly get up to move the roomba once it gets stuck due to the fact that it thinks its about to hit a cliff.
    • Despite the nice video and claims made by them, this item will not go onto even very thin rugs if they have a dark colored border
    • We also found the 690 refusing to vacuum the area rugs because the black or dark blue color in the rug set off the cliff detector so it refused to vacuum those areas
    • I think dark colors might throw the Roomba off so beware
    • Roomba support told me that there is no setting in software to turn off the cliff detector so no way the 690 will allow itself to vacuum any dark colored rugs
